How to set up IPTV on Firestick and Fire TV.

Fire TV menus and app availability change over time. Check the device model, Fire OS version, free storage, and the player's official installation instructions before beginning.

Before you start

  • A supported Fire TV device connected to your home network
  • Account details supplied through an approved channel
  • Enough free device storage
  • The official source for your chosen player

1. Install a compatible player

Prefer the Amazon Appstore or the player's documented source. Do not download renamed APK files from unknown websites. Availability varies, so this guide does not publish unverified downloader codes.

2. Add your account

Open the player and select the account method supplied with your plan, such as a portal login or playlist URL. Keep the credentials private.

04

3. Allow the guide to load

Large lineups and program-guide data can take time on the first load. Avoid repeatedly closing the app during the initial sync.

05

4. Check playback

Test a standard-quality stream first. If it works, then test higher-quality sources. This separates a basic login problem from a device or bandwidth limitation.

If playback fails

  • Restart the player and Fire TV
  • Confirm the date and time are correct
  • Test the same account on one other supported device
  • Check simultaneous connection limits
